Beautiful Layla was pulled from a high kill shelter where she was discovered shaking in distress and pain. Her primary health issue was advanced demodectic mange. It was a slow recovery but with the tender care of her foster family, she has been restored to complete health.
Layla is a fun loving clown! She is always ready to romp and play with her human and canine friends. From the moment she first meets you she will be your bff, especially if you heed her begging for a belly rub! In fact the biggest problem you will have with her is keeping her in an upright position as the girl lives for belly rubs!! She is a great snuggler and is very gentle when taking treats from your hand. Layla knows her basic commands, she is leash trained, house trained and comfortable being crated for reasonable time periods.
Her beautiful blue brindle coloring will turn heads wherever you take her and her sweet disposition and excellent manners will make fans of even the skeptics.
Layla does not do well with cats and therefore no home with a resident cat will be considered.
